Samajwadi Party (SP) chief Akhilesh Yadav has announced the launch of ‘Stree Honor-Samriddhi Yojana’ in 2027. He has described the scheme as a major step for empowerment of women and girls.

Akhilesh Yadav shared information about the scheme through a post on social media platform X (Twitter). He said that under this every girl, woman and woman will be empowered.

Apart from this, Akhilesh Yadav also announced to provide mobiles to women and girls and provide laptops to talented students, so that they can move forward in their education and career.

Key points of the plan

Akhilesh Yadav also posted a video sharing the information of ‘Stree Samman-Samriddhi Yojana’. It was told that under the scheme:

Financial assistance will be sent directly to women’s bank accounts.
Free mobiles will be given to women and women.
Laptops will be provided to meritorious girl students, so that they can move forward in their studies and career.

Akhilesh Yadav said that big steps will be taken to make women financially self -sufficient if the socialist government is formed.

Financial assistance schemes for women in other states

In many states of India, governments are running various schemes to make women self -reliant and promote their economic empowerment. Through these schemes, women are given direct economic benefits, so that they can improve their standard of living.

1. Madhya Pradesh: Ladli Bahna Yojana

  • Start: 2023
  • Benefits: Financial assistance of ₹ 1200 to women every month.

2. Maharashtra: Majhi Ladki Bahin Scheme

  • Benefits: Financial assistance of ₹ 1500 to women every month.

3. Chhattisgarh: Mahtari Vandan Yojana

  • Benefits: Financial assistance of ₹ 1000 every month.

4. Jharkhand: Mayian Samman Yojana

  • Benefits: Women are provided financial assistance of up to ₹ 3000.

‘Mahila Samriddhi Yojana’ in Delhi

The new BJP government in Delhi announced the launch of ‘Mahila Samriddhi Yojana’. Under this scheme, ₹ 2500 will be given to women every month.

Its registration will start from 8 March.

Chief Minister Kanya Sumangala scheme in Uttar Pradesh

The Uttar Pradesh government is running ‘Chief Minister Kanya Sumangala Yojana’, which provides financial assistance from birth to their education.

The purpose of this scheme is to make girls’ education and future safe.
